Exploring Various Types of Floor Coatings
Floor coatings are available in a diverse range of materials, each possessing unique qualities that cater to various needs and preferences. Among the most commonly utilized are epoxy coatings, renowned for their durability and resistance to deteriorative factors like heat, impact, and chemicals. This makes them a popular choice for heavy-duty environments such as factories, garages, and warehouses. Nevertheless, for those seeking environmentally friendly options, there are ‘green’ coatings formulated from natural, biodegradable substances, like plant resins and vegetable oils.
Polyurethane, prized for its excellent adhesion and flexibility, is another noteworthy option in the realm of floor coatings. This type is especially beneficial for areas that witness heavy footfall because it can withstand high traffic without chipping or peeling. Meanwhile, for more decorative purposes, there are acid-stained, dyed, painted, and topical sealed coatings that are perfect for enhancing the aesthetic appeal of interior spaces. These can be customized to incorporate a multitude of colors, textures, and designs, allowing for a greater degree of personalization.

Examining an Industrial Floor Coating Project
One of the most comprehensive projects to examine involves the process of industrial floor coating. Such a project necessitates stringent attention to detail due to the magnitude of the workspace and the intense conditions under which the floor must perform. With heavy machinery, extreme temperature variations, corrosive substances, and high traffic areas, industrial floor coatings must demonstrate robustness and resilience while serving a myriad of functionalities.
Three vital components dictate the success of these undertakings: coating material selection, precise application, and rigorous maintenance. The choice of coating substance often hinges on the specific industry requirements. For instance, epoxy coatings are preferred in industries where durability is paramount, while polyurethane coatings offer excellent resistance to chemicals and abrasions, making them suitable for manufacturing plants. The application, on the other hand, must be painstakingly consistent, ensuring every inch of the floor is uniformly coated to guarantee optimal performance. Regular maintenance includes regular cleaning, prompt repair of any wear and tear, and periodic recoating to sustain the longevity of the floor.
An Outdoor Floor Coating Project: A Detailed Study
Outdoor floor coating projects entail their own unique set of demands and conditions, largely driven by the constant exposure to natural elements. The need for durability, anti-slip properties, and weather-resistance feature prominently, alongside factors like aesthetic appeal and compatibility with existing outdoor elements. Striking the balance between these parameters can be quite a task, which makes the choice of materials and technique crucial in the success of such projects.
A case study of a recent outdoor floor coating project reveals the implementation of some of the industry’s innovative approaches. The project involved a large poolside area, where the existing concrete flooring posed myriad of problems- from heat absorption, contributing to uncomfortably hot surfaces in sunny weather, to the lack of grip when wet. The solution entailed the use of a high quality epoxy coating with embedded quartz for added grip, coupled with a UV-resistant sealer to minimize heat absorption. The outcome transformed not just the aesthetics of the space, but significantly improved functionality as well, providing a comfortable and safe surface for users.
